claud925 Posted August 6, 2007 #3 Share Posted August 6, 2007 You are comparing two different category cabins. 7049 is 170 sq. ft. - that triangular balcony is larger than the normal 2C @ 39 sq. ft. (I'd guess about 60 sq. ft.). 6135 is Concierge-Class - 191 sq. ft. 6135 is also only one of four CC cabins on deck 6 that has the oversized (teak floor) balcony, and would probably measure in the vicinity of about 80 sq. ft. . . . If you can afford the upgrade from 2C to CC, and one of the 4 CC cabins available on Deck 6 is 6135, make the switch - you won't be sorry.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

RLM77 Posted August 7, 2007 #9 Share Posted August 7, 2007 I agree that 6135 is the better choice for most; from what I've seen (from the ship's exterior) it's more than big enough for two loungers, never mind one. So that you have the complete picture, though, note that 6135 is a connecting cabin to the Royal Suite next door. Some people on these boards have complained about the smell of cigarette smoke coming through connecting doors. However, we had a connector on Mercury (1241) and had absolutely no problems with it; the door was well sealed and kept out both noise and smoke (if any) from the next-door Sky Suite. I fully agree with the other posters -- if you can afford Concierge Class you should definitely grab this cabin. It will make your trip.
